New weekday schedule from GaLaBau 2026

GaLaBau 2026 will usher in a change that has been requested by both exhibitors and visitors, as the event will then be held on different days of the week. In future, the leading international fair for urban green and open spaces will run from Tuesday to Friday instead of Wednesday to Saturday. There will be no change to the two-year cycle, September timing or four-day duration.

“We believe it is important to announce this major change in good time, to allow participants to reliably plan ahead and to show that we are taking the change requested by exhibitors seriously and implementing it in a timely fashion,” says Stefan Dittrich, Director GaLaBau at NürnbergMesse. “Visitors, especially from gardening and landscaping businesses, will also welcome this change because in future they will no longer have to use up a Saturday to visit the fair.”

“We are confident that the response to this change will be extremely positive and that it will make GaLaBau even stronger for the future,” adds Thomas Banzhaf, President of the BGL (German Association for Gardening, Landscaping and Sports Ground Construction), the honorary sponsor of GaLaBau.

Reasons for new Tuesday to Friday schedule from GaLaBau 2026

The event will no longer include a Saturday, as this is the day that attracts the lowest number of visitors. Instead, GaLaBau 2026 will run from Tuesday 15 September to Friday 18 September. The event will therefore still last four days. This adjustment is in response to an explicit preference by the sector. Exhibitors had spoken out very clearly in favour of a change – “The Saturday has to go!” Among other reasons, this means that when it comes to dismantling their stands, they are not affected by the ban on driving trucks on Sundays. This results in a much more relaxed and less costly scenario for exhibitors. But GaLaBau will also be even more attractive to visitors. International visitors in particular find that their return journey is easier if it can be made before the weekend. The new schedule also ensures a more even distribution of visitors over the four weekdays. More homogeneous visitor numbers are an added benefit to visitors and exhibitors, because they allow for better and more intensive discussion opportunities.

About GaLaBau

GaLaBau is the international, all-encompassing show for the design, construction and maintenance of urban, green and open spaces. It will take place for the 25th time on 11–14 September 2024. Its trade visitors are businesses in the gardening, landscaping and open space development sector and landscape architects and planners at federal, state and local authorities, in addition to dealers in powered equipment and agricultural machinery. The perfect complement to the trade fair is an extensive range of products and services for operators of leisure parks, camping areas and kindergartens, in addition to those in charge of the construction, maintenance and management of golf courses. The honorary sponsor and founder of GaLaBau is the German Association of Gardening, Landscaping and Sports Ground Construction (Bundesverband Garten-, Landschafts- und Sportplatzbau, BGL), with NürnbergMesse as organiser. At GaLaBau 2022, some 62,000 trade visitors learned about the latest developments and innovations in horticulture, landscaping and sports facilities from more than 1,093 exhibitors.
